Close to where you live or work, the Campbell County Medical Group (CCMG) Wright Clinic & Occupational Health has a friendly and knowledgeable staff ready to assist with your healthcare needs for the entire family.
Occupational Health can assist with the development of health policies, functional job descriptions, health education and many other services. Programs are specific to each company's needs and require a contract agreement. Learn more
We have good news! CCH Rehabilitation Services offers a satellite physical therapy clinic in Wright, Wyoming.

Physical therapy sessions include a one-hour evaluation followed by an individualized care plan.
A licensed physical therapist is at the Wright Clinic regularly from 8 AM -1 PM every Tuesday and Thursday—additional hours can be requested. For scheduling and questions, please contact Rehabilitation Services at 307-688-8000.
